Job Summary

We are seeking a highly motivated and compassionate Paraprofessional - Behavior Support to join our team at YAI/iHOPE. As a key member of our school community, you will play a vital role in supporting students with complex needs, providing comprehensive services, and promoting their social, emotional, adaptive, and educational advancement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ist assigned students in achieving their academic and behavioral goals, working closely with teachers, therapists, and other support staff.
  • Implement individualized IEPs and behavior plans, ensuring the health and safety of students, staff, and others.
  • Provide support for students inside and outside the classroom, enabling them to fully participate in school activities and related services.
  • Assist therapists with related service sessions, transferring and positioning students as needed.
  • Support students with self-care, including using the restroom, basic hygiene, feeding, and other essential tasks.
  • Follow all policies and procedures related to student care and safety, ensuring a positive and inclusive learning environment.
Requirements
  • High school diploma or equivalent required; associate's degree or coursework in education preferred.
  • One to three years of relevant healthcare, childcare, or school-based experience preferred.
  • First Aid, CPR, and AED certification preferred.
Preferred Qualifications
  • At least one year of experience working in an ABA environment or equivalent role for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ities.
  • Ability to demonstrate positive behavioral support and understand behavior as communication.
  • Formal training in psychology, sociology, human behavior, mental health, special education, and/or intellectual/developmental disabilities preferred.
  •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) certification preferred.
